The Chancellor's Awards for Excellence program is now accepting nominations for the 2020 awards. These awards recognize UAA employees for extraordinary work and dedication to our students and university community. This year's program includes several changes, including two new awards and expanded eligibility for nominees. New for 2020:

  • For categories issuing two awards, one will go to the Anchorage campus and one will go to a community campus. Previously, winners were selected without regard to campus location.
  • Sustainability is now Climate Change Impact. Previously awarded to individuals for "reducing UAA's impact on the environment," the expanded criteria now also considers candidates who increase "our understanding or the impacts of climate change through teaching, research or community service." Eligibility has been extended to students (in addition to staff or faculty) at any campus.
  • A new award category, Transformation and Change Agent, honors faculty or staff who made a significant and positive contribution toward support and implementation of a major organizational change. Two awards are available.
  • Also new this year, the Friend and Advocate category recognizes individuals and organizations outside UAA for support of (other than financial) and advocacy for the university and its mission. Two awards are available.
  • Two categories — Safety and Operational Effectiveness — were eliminated due to insufficient nominations in prior years.

The nomination process is simple and easily completed in 15-20 minutes. For most categories, nominators only need to provide basic nominee information and a short answer (250 words or fewer) as to how the candidate meets the criteria.

Submit your nominations by Friday, March 6, 2020. Winners will be announced in early April.
